Summit and cascades down to the kīpahulu district's black volcanic sands More than 24,000 acres of wilderness Haleakalā national park is a national park of the united states located on the island of maui, hawaii Named after haleakalā, a dormant volcano within its boundaries, the park covers an area of 33,265 acres (52.0 sq mi
134.6 km 2), [1] of which 24,719 acres (38.6 sq mi 100.0 km 2) is a wilderness area
